Visiting FCI Bastrop: Guidelines and Procedures
Planning a journey to the Federal Correctional Institution (FCI) Bastrop? It's important to be aware of the guidelines and procedures in place to ensure a smooth and safe experience for both visitors and inmates.
First, you'll need to file a acceptable visitor application. This can usually be obtained on the FCI Bastrop website or through the Bureau of Prisons. Once your application is authorized, you'll receive specific instructions for scheduling your visit.
On the day of your visit, be sure to get there at least 60 minutes early to allow time for inspection. You'll need to present a recognized photo ID and complete a security screening.
Remember to comply with all FCI Bastrop rules and regulations during your visit. This includes:
* Keeping a respectful and courteous demeanor at all times.
* Refraining from any talking about of illegal actions.
* Abstain from bringing in restricted items, such as:
* Firearms
* Substances
* Electronics
